Output e653ec65ab78425c5d41437b0b2f8ea4a8904c3016eb3ef5c05e83fb2bc46739:11

value
108346000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 354865ec39c63d95c7bbed3f1c16a245569fe57c OP_EQUAL
address
36YkU2CLDeaTqRU1d6yAEYvoC4szaBEssD
transaction
e653ec65ab78425c5d41437b0b2f8ea4a8904c3016eb3ef5c05e83fb2bc46739
spent
true